Useful when mold may need isolation from clean areas during removal.
Ask what containment, air movement, or negative-air process is included in the work.
Important when mold appears after a leak, flood, roof issue, or damp basement condition.
Ask how they identify and address the moisture source before or during remediation.
Helpful when you need inspection, sampling, or clearance questions separated from removal work.
Ask whether testing is included, handled separately, or referred to an independent process.

Best for: Athens and metro Atlanta homeowners dealing with water damage who want a single company to handle mitigation, mold testing, and remediation under one roof with insurance coordination.
Service area: Headquartered in Bogart, Georgia, near Athens. Serclean lists offices in Athens, Atlanta, Marietta, Norcross, Columbus, Savannah, and Richmond Hill in Georgia, plus locations in Nashville and other Tennessee cities, Charleston in South Carolina, Concord in North Carolina, Fort Walton Beach in Florida, and Daphne in Alabama. That is a six-state footprint, which is unusually broad for a family-owned company. Confirm crew availability and response times for your specific location.
Review snapshot: Andrew, James, and Nick draw consistent praise for clear explanations and fast response. But 20 negative reviews across 688 total flag a pattern of billing disputes, liens, and unresponsive office staff.
Best for: Northeast Georgia homeowners dealing with water damage or post-flood mold in the Hoschton, Jefferson, and Jackson County area who want a restoration company that handles cleanup through reconstruction under one roof.
Service area: Headquartered in Hoschton, Georgia, serving northeast Georgia including Jackson County, Jefferson, Braselton, Buford, Flowery Branch, Gainesville, Winder, and Commerce. Part of a larger Penco Restoration operation with a second office in Sharpsburg serving the Newnan and south metro Atlanta area. The website lists dozens of cities across metro Atlanta and the greater Southeast, which is a very broad claim for a company with two physical offices.
Review snapshot: Andy, Luis, Gil, and Kyle draw repeated praise for communication and follow-through across 61 reviews at 5.0 stars. But with zero negative reviews on record, there is no complaint pattern to weigh against.
